Digital Design: With an Introduction to the Verilog HDL, VHDL, and SystemVerilog is a comprehensive guide for introductory courses in digital design within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, or Computer Science departments. Authored by M. Morris Mano and published by Pearson in March 2017 as part of the 6th edition, this book offers a clear and accessible approach to understanding the fundamental concepts of digital design. It covers essential tools for designing digital circuits and includes procedures applicable across various digital applications. The text supports a multimodal learning approach, emphasizing digital design irrespective of the language used. Recognizing the importance of Verilog, VHDL, and SystemVerilog in today’s digital device design flows, this edition presents parallel tracks for these languages while allowing students to focus on one primary language.
